Unified Storage Across Proton Services
I would love to see Proton unify its storage across all services.
Right now, Proton services have separate storage limits in the free plan:
Proton Mail: 500 MB (upgradable to 1 GB through setup tasks)
Proton Drive: up to 5 GB (after completing setup or boost tasks)
For paid plans, Proton already provides shared storage between Mail and Drive, but not for the free tier.
It would be great if free users could also have a single shared storage pool, for example 5 GB total across Mail, Drive, Calendar, and other Proton services, instead of isolated limits for each.
